If not, see <http://www.gnu.org/licenses/>. */ 18 19#include <config.h> 20 21/* Specification. */ 22#ifdef SAFE_WRITE 23# include "safe-write.h" 24#else 25# include "safe-read.h" 26#endif 27 28/* Get ssize_t. */ 29#include <sys/types.h> 30#include <unistd.h> 31 32#include <errno.h> 33 34#ifdef EINTR 35# define IS_EINTR(x) ((x) == EINTR) 36#else 37# define IS_EINTR(x) 0 38#endif 39 40#include <limits.h> 41 42#ifdef SAFE_WRITE 43# define safe_rw safe_write 44# define rw write 45#else 46# define safe_rw safe_read 47# define rw read 48# undef const 49# define const /* empty */ 50#endif 51 52/* Read(write) up to COUNT bytes at BUF from(to) descriptor FD, retrying if 53 interrupted. Return the actual number of bytes read(written), zero for EOF, 54 or SAFE_READ_ERROR(SAFE_WRITE_ERROR) upon error. */ 55size_t 56safe_rw (int fd, void const *buf, size_t count) 57{ 58 /* Work around a bug in Tru64 5.1. Attempting to read more than 59 INT_MAX bytes fails with errno == EINVAL. See 60 <http://lists.gnu.org/archive/html/bug-gnu-utils/2002-04/msg00010.html>. 61 When decreasing COUNT, keep it block-aligned. */ 62 enum { BUGGY_READ_MAXIMUM = INT_MAX & ~8191 }; 63 64 for (;;) 65 { 66 ssize_t result = rw (fd, buf, count); 67 68 if (0 <= result) 69 return result; 70 else if (IS_EINTR (errno)) 71 continue; 72 else if (errno == EINVAL && BUGGY_READ_MAXIMUM < count) 73 count = BUGGY_READ_MAXIMUM; 74 else 75 return result; 76 } 77} 78
